#7c5f26 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#7c5f26 is composed of 48.6% red, 37.3% green and 14.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 23.4% magenta, 69.4% yellow and 51.4% black. It has a hue angle of 39.8 degrees, a saturation of 53.1% and a lightness of 31.8%. #7c5f26 color hex could be obtained by blending #f8be4c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#7c5f26 color description : Dark moderate orange.
The hexadecimal color #7c5f26 has RGB values of R:124, G:95, B:38 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.23, Y:0.69,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 8150822.
